Score 94/100 · Drink 2023-2033, Jeb Dunnuck, Oct 2023

Purchased at a restaurant in Napa, the 2012 Cabernet Sauvignon Estate showed reasonably well, but it’s clearly a step back from the magical 2013. Mature darker currants, blackberries, smoked tobacco, licorice, and lead pencil notes all define the aromatics, and it's full-bodied on the palate, with a layered, ripe mouthfeel, good mid-palate density, and outstanding length. If this bottle is representative, it's fully mature today with another decade of prime drinking ahead of it.

Score 94/100 · Drink 2017-2032, Antonio Galloni, Vinous, Dec 2014

Freshly cut flowers, spices, mocha, red plums, spice cake and new leather meld together in Staglin's 2012 Cabernet Sauvignon. Radiant and supple throughout, the 2012 captures the personality of the year in spades. Sweet red berries, mint and flowers add nuance on the creamy, textured finish. The 2012 will drink well pretty much right out of the gate, but I would give it at least a few years in bottle, as the oak is a bit prominent at this stage.

Score 96/100 · Drink 2014-2034, Robert Parker, Oct 2014

One of the greatest Cabernet Sauvignons yet made by the Staglins is the 2012 Cabernet Sauvignon Estate 30th Anniversary. It boasts a dense ruby/purple color along with a big, sweet bouquet of crème de cassis, camphor, incense, blackberries and high quality, subtle toast in the background. There is great fruit on the attack and the wine fills out beautifully in the mid-palate. Full-bodied and opulent, this is a classic yet voluptuous example of the 2012 Napa Cabernet Sauvignon crop. It will be delicious young, but age beautifully for two decades or more.
